Like the other animated prehistoric adventure sequels in this series, this tenth outing for cute young 'longneck' dinosaur Littlefoot is a far cry from the dark tone of the first.
It's a lively, if flatly-animated adventure with songs, which sees orphaned Littlefoot and his grandparents leaving the Great Valley for the unknown, after the longnecks all have the same series of 'sleep stories' (dreams) about the 'great circle' (sun) falling.
The main thrust of this one is that Littlefoot finally meets his long-lost father (voiced by Kiefer Sutherland).
New characters, as well as Sutherland's, include a grizzled old dino voiced by James Garner. As always, it's a little preachy in its morals, but pre-schoolers should love it.
